What It Does

The plugin creates a dedicated indexing page on your journal’s website, displaying the databases and indexes you’re listed in as a clean, professional logo gallery. Think of it as your journal’s credibility wall — a single page where visitors immediately see that your journal meets the standards of major indexing services.

You don’t need any coding or template editing skills. Everything is managed through the OJS admin panel: upload a logo, add a label, set the display order, and you’re done. The page is generated automatically and integrates with your journal’s existing navigation.

Key Features

The plugin supports both English and Turkish out of the box, making it particularly useful for journals in Turkey and bilingual publications. You can add as many index entries as needed, each with its own logo and label. The layout is responsive and adapts to any OJS theme, so it looks good on desktop and mobile alike.

Since it works with OJS 3.3+, there’s no need to upgrade your installation to use it.

Get Started

Download the plugin from GitHub, upload it via Website → Plugins → Upload a New Plugin in your OJS dashboard, and enable it. Then head to the plugin settings to start adding your index entries.
